How Our Kitchen Water Damage Restoration Service Works
Our team’s process for Kitchen Water Damage Restoration is meticulous and thorough. We understand that a proper process is crucial to preventing further damage and ensuring your kitchen is safe to use. When corners are cut, you risk costly repairs and potential health hazards. Our team takes the time to assess the damage, extract water, dry and dehumidify the area, and repair or replace damaged materials.
Step 1: Assessment and Water Extraction
Our technicians use specialized equipment to extract water from your kitchen, including wet/dry vacuums and submersible pumps. We’ll thoroughly remove standing water, reducing the risk of further damage and promoting a safe environment for drying and dehumidification.
Step 2: Drying and Dehumidification
Once the water is extracted, we’ll use high-speed fans and dehumidifiers to dry the area completely. This step is critical in preventing mold growth and further damage. You can expect this process to take 3-5 days, depending on the severity of the damage.
Step 3: Cleaning and Sanitizing
After drying and dehumidification, our team will thoroughly clean and sanitize the affected area. This includes washing walls and ceilings, disinfecting surfaces, and removing any remaining moisture. We use eco-friendly cleaning products that are safe for you and your family.
Step 4: Repair and Reconstruction
Once the area is clean and dry, our technicians will repair or replace damaged materials, such as cabinets, countertops, and flooring. We’ll also restore any damaged plumbing or electrical parts.
Step 5: Final Inspection and Touch-ups
Our team will perform a final inspection to ensure the job is done to your satisfaction. We’ll address any remaining issues and provide a detailed report of the work completed.

Warning Signs You Need Kitchen Water Damage Restoration
Ignoring the warning signs of water damage can lead to costly repairs and potential health hazards. Be aware of the following signs and take action immediately if you spot them:
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Strong, persistent odors can show water damage or high humidity in your kitchen. Don’t ignore this warning sign – it’s a sign of potential mold growth and further damage.
Warping or Discoloration on Walls and Ceilings
Water damage can cause warping, discoloration, or staining on walls and ceilings. Address this issue quickly to prevent further damage and potential health risks.
Increased Humidity or Water Stains
Visible water stains or increased humidity levels can show water damage. Don’t wait – address this issue immediately to prevent further damage and potential health hazards.
Cracked or Broken Tiles or Flooring
Cracked or broken tiles or flooring can be a sign of water damage. Address this issue quickly to prevent further damage and potential health risks.
Bulging or Warped Cabinets or Countertops
Bulging or warped cabinets or countertops can be a sign of water damage. Don’t ignore this warning sign – it’s a sign of potential further damage and health hazards.

Kitchen Water Damage Restoration Cost in Greensboro, NC
The cost of Kitchen Water Damage Restoration in Greensboro, NC varies based on the severity and size of the affected area. Our team offers free estimates to help you understand the costs involved. Here’s a breakdown of some typical price ranges: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water Extraction | $500 – $2,500 | Severity and size of the affected area |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of the affected area and equipment needed |
| Repair or Replacement of Damaged Materials | $2,000 – $10,000 | Severity of the damage and materials needed |
| Cleaning and Sanitizing | $500 – $2,000 | Size of the affected area and equipment needed |
| Final Inspection and Touch-ups | $500 – $1,000 | Size of the affected area and equipment needed |
Exact pricing depends on an on-site assessment. Our team will provide you with a detailed estimate and answer any questions you may have.

Common Questions About Kitchen Water Damage Restoration
How Long Does Kitchen Water Damage Restoration Take?
Our team works efficiently to complete the restoration process as quickly as possible. But, the timeline depends on the severity of the damage and the size of the affected area. On average, it takes 3-5 days to complete the process.
Is Kitchen Water Damage Restoration Covered by Insurance?
Yes, kitchen water damage restoration is typically covered by homeowners’ insurance policies. But, the specifics of your coverage depend on your policy and the circumstances of the damage.
How Do I Prevent Kitchen Water Damage?
Preventing kitchen water damage is easier than you think. Regularly inspect your kitchen’s plumbing and appliances, address any issues quickly, and maintain a safe and dry kitchen environment.
